Date:1931
Description:Laura Husselbee (nee Dutton) and Gladys Bayliss with Laura's son Philip Husselbee on a rocking horse owned by John Beech. Mr.Beech, who had been butler to the Salt family at Weeping Cross and later to Lady Salt at Walton on the Hill, had a collection of Victorian mechanical toys at his home in Walton on the Hill.
